A Beginner‘s Guide to the Internet‘s Favorite Cryptocurrency294
A new world of digital currency has swept the globe, and among the most intriguing and beloved stars in the cryptosphere is Dogecoin. Born from a playful meme, Dogecoin has evolved into a force to be reckoned with, attracting a loyal community of supporters and sparking interest within the mainstream financial realm.
Dogecoin owes its origins to two software engineers, Billy Markus and Jackson Palmer, who in 2013 embarked on a mission to create a cryptocurrency that would stand out from the seriousness that had come to characterize the market. Drawing inspiration from the popular Shiba Inu "Doge" meme, they launched Dogecoin as a lighthearted and accessible alternative to Bitcoin.
Dogecoin's whimsical nature, coupled with its unique features, quickly resonated with the online community. Its low transaction costs and high transaction speeds made it an attractive option for everyday use, while its uncapped supply set it apart from the deflationary economics of Bitcoin.
As Dogecoin's popularity surged, so too did its value. In 2021, the cryptocurrency experienced a meteoric rise, propelled by a combination of viral marketing campaigns, celebrity endorsements, and mainstream adoption. Elon Musk, the eccentric CEO of Tesla and SpaceX, became a vocal advocate for Dogecoin, further boosting its appeal.
Beyond its speculative value, Dogecoin has also emerged as a vehicle for social good. The Dogecoin Foundation, a non-profit organization established to promote the development and adoption of the cryptocurrency, has actively supported charitable causes, including disaster relief efforts and animal welfare initiatives.
However, Dogecoin has not been immune to the volatility inherent in the cryptocurrency market. Its value has been subject to significant fluctuations, causing both elation and disappointment among investors. Despite these price swings, Dogecoin's loyal community has remained steadfast in their belief in its long-term potential.
